Output 86518ecdcbfc8e4cebe6598f5b555b2b96adc514faa20d51f40daf34de63a89a:3

value
179528730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8c00f3c05bf1be8c6b86288c498b5ba00adf50 OP_EQUAL
address
37DABgYJgSHxHoU7dix5LsxNcRoj5VRQJz
transaction
86518ecdcbfc8e4cebe6598f5b555b2b96adc514faa20d51f40daf34de63a89a
spent
true